What are the responsibilities and job description for the Production Operator - Pharmaceuticals position at Mohnark Pharmaceuticals Inc?
Key Responsibilities
Weigh, fill, and package raw materials, semi-finished goods and finished products according to Good Manufacturing Practices and quality assurance guidelines with the aim of completing correct production orders.
Clean equipment/workstations and check for possible residue with the aim of working in a clean environment that is in line with the quality requirements.
Use Good Documentation Practices to record weights, working times, activities, and possible deviations on controlled documents in a timely manner.
Operate machine(s) with the aim of being responsible for the optimum functioning and output of these machines.
Maintain professional knowledge with the aim of maximizing one’s own professional knowledge and applying it in an optimum manner within the organization.
Other duties as assigned.
